    Keldamuzik sits down with actor–entrepreneur Samuel Lynn to trace his path from community theater and on-set stand-in work to landing principal roles and producing his own projects. Samuel shares the craft lessons that shaped him—improv discipline, character study, and learning to take “no” without losing momentum—plus the moment he pivoted from waiting on auditions to creating opportunities. He breaks down how he built a lean production slate, monetized brand partnerships, and used social proof to secure investors. The convo unpacks balancing set life with business ops, protecting IP, forming the right LLC/teams, and measuring ROI beyond vanity metrics. Samuel closes with practical advice for emerging talent: build a repeatable audition routine, document everything, network with intention, and treat your career like a startup.
